MN Drops Reciprocal Agreement with WI Effective 1/1/10

As you may be aware, Minnesota will end individual income tax reciprocity with Wisconsin effective January 1, 2010. This change will automatically be reflected in your NetSuite account.


IMPORTANT:
There are reportorial requirements with regard to the termination of the reciprocity agreement so please contact your Tax Consultant or the State Tax Agency for details.
